diff --git a/.drone.yml b/.drone.yml deleted file mode 100644 index 0a437f2..0000000 --- a/.drone.yml +++ /dev/null @@ -1,28 +0,0 @@ -kind: pipeline -name: build & release - -steps: -- name: fetch tags - image: docker:git - commands: - - git fetch --tags - when: - event: tag -- name: test - image: golang:1.14 - commands: - - go test -v . - when: - event: - exclude: - - tag -- name: release - image: golang:1.14 - environment: - GITEA_TOKEN: - from_secret: goreleaser_gitea_token - commands: - - curl -sL https://git.io/goreleaser | bash - when: - event: tag - diff --git a/.github/workflows/goreleaser.yml b/.github/workflows/goreleaser.yml new file mode 100644 index 0000000..501e66d --- /dev/null +++ b/.github/workflows/goreleaser.yml @@ -0,0 +1,24 @@ +name: goreleaser + +on: + pull_request: + push: + +jobs: + goreleaser: + runs-on: ubuntu-latest + steps: + - name: Checkout + uses: actions/checkout@v2 + - name: Set up Go + uses: actions/setup-go@v2 + with: + go-version: 1.16 + - name: Run goreleaser + uses: goreleaser/goreleaser-action@v2 + with: + distribution: goreleaser + version: latest + args: release --rm-dist + env: + GITHUB_TOKEN: ${{ secrets.GORELEASER_GITHUB_TOKEN }} diff --git a/.goreleaser.yml b/.goreleaser.yml index ecd0dac..4fc437c 100644 --- a/.goreleaser.yml +++ b/.goreleaser.yml @@ -25,9 +25,6 @@ changelog: - '^test:' release: - gitea: + github: owner: tdemin name: syg_go - -gitea_urls: - api: https://git.tdem.in/api/v1/ diff --git a/README.md b/README.md index 679349c..61feacc 100644 --- a/README.md +++ b/README.md @@ -7,7 +7,7 @@ threads for mining. It is based on `cmd/genkeys` from yggdrasil-go. ### Installation -`% go get -u -v git.tdem.in/tdemin/syg_go` +`% go get -u -v github.com/tdemin/syg_go` If you're an Arch Linux user, you can install it from [AUR](https://aur.archlinux.org/packages/syg_go/): diff --git a/go.mod b/go.mod index 177a941..34c07bb 100644 --- a/go.mod +++ b/go.mod @@ -1,4 +1,4 @@ -module git.tdem.in/tdemin/syg_go +module github.com/tdemin/syg_go go 1.16